| /** |
| * Get the full lowercase mapping for c. |
| * @param iter Character iterator to check for context for SpecialCasing. |
| * The current index must be on the character after c. |
| * This function may or may not change the iterator index. |
| * If iter==NULL then a context-independent result is returned. |
| * @return the length of the output, negative if same as c |
| * @internal |
| */ |
| U_CAPI int32_t U_EXPORT2 |
| u_internalToLower(UChar32 c, UCharIterator *iter, |
| UChar *dest, int32_t destCapacity, |
| const char *locale); |

| /** |
| * NUL-terminate a UChar * string if possible. |
| * If length < destCapacity then NUL-terminate. |
| * If length == destCapacity then do not terminate but set U_STRING_NOT_TERMINATED_WARNING. |
| * If length > destCapacity then do not terminate but set U_BUFFER_OVERFLOW_ERROR. |
| * |
| * @param dest Destination buffer, can be NULL if destCapacity==0. |
| * @param destCapacity Number of UChars available at dest. |
| * @param length Number of UChars that were (to be) written to dest. |
| * @param pErrorCode ICU error code. |
| * @return length |
| * @internal |
| */ |
| U_CAPI int32_t U_EXPORT2 |
| u_terminateUChars(UChar *dest, int32_t destCapacity, int32_t length, UErrorCode *pErrorCode); |
